Diseased cucumber plants with symptoms of decline and root knots were collected from a crop in the municipality of Faxinal do Soturno, Rio Grande do Sul state, Brazil. Morphological (perineal patterns), biochemical (esterase phenotypes) and molecular (D2–D3 region) studies allowed to identify parasitizing nematodes, such as Meloidogyne arenaria. To our knowledge, this is the first report of Meloidogyne arenaria on Cucumber in Rio Grande do Sul State, Brazil.
